Qualified Social Worker – Assessment Team – Carmarthenshire County Council

Carmarthenshire County Council is recruiting an experienced Assessment Social Worker to join their Education & Children’s Service team, based at Ty Elwyn. This role is key in supporting families and safeguarding children by delivering detailed assessments and expert court reports in line with the All Wales Pledge.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Complete complex parenting assessments, including attachment analysis and parenting capacity assessments.
  • Assess connected persons and provide analysis on family dynamics and support networks.
  • Prepare Special Guardianship Reports for court proceedings.
  • Provide clear and analytical risk assessments, advising on parents’ capacity for change and risk management strategies.
  • Deliver high-quality court reports and represent the local authority in legal proceedings.
  • Work collaboratively with families, carers, and partner agencies to ensure the safety and wellbeing of children.

Essential Requirements:

  • Qualified Social Worker (QSW) with Social Work England registration.
  • Minimum of 3 years’ post-qualified social work experience.
  • Strong background in parenting assessments, connected persons assessments, and Special Guardianship work.
  • Extensive court work experience and understanding of child protection legislation.
  • Excellent analytical, assessment, and report-writing skills.

Additional Information:

  • Based at Ty Elwyn, Carmarthenshire County Council.
  • Full-time: 37 hours per week (Monday to Friday, 08:45 – 17:00).
  • Inside IR35.
  • Pay rate aligned to All Wales Pledge
